Lions lose Roodt

The Golden Lions have suffered three new injuries after their 38-23 win over the Free State Cheetahs last Saturday.

The major loss is lock Hendrik Roodt, who recently recovered from injury. Roodt is expected to be out for the season as he suffered a shoulder dislocation.

Flank Willie Britz and wing Deon Helberg are also out of action with wrist and ankle injuries respectively.

The Lions are already without scrumhalf Whestley Moolman (arm) and lock Stephan Greeff (leg) for the rest of the season. Flank Derick Minnie (knee), flyhalf Guy Cronje (hamstring) and centre Waylon Murray (knee) are recovering and are set to make their returns over the next two to three weeks.

There is some good news for the Lions as flank Jaco Kriel and prop CJ van der Linde rejoined the squad at training on Monday.
